Molecular Biology: Structure and Dynamics of Genomes and Proteomes 2nd edition illustrates the essential principles behind the transmission and expression of genetic information at the level of DNA, RNA, and proteins. Emphasis is on the experimental basis of discovery and the most recent advances in the field while presenting a rigorous, yet still concise, summary of the structural mechanisms of molecular biology. Topics new to this edition include the CRISPR-Cas gene editing system, Coronaviruses - structure, genome, vaccine and drug development, and newly-recognised mechanisms for transcription termination. The text is written for advanced undergraduate or graduate-level courses in molecular biology.
Key Features
* Highlights the experimental basis of important discoveries in molecular biology
* Thoroughly updated with new information on gene editing tools, viruses, and transcription mechanisms, termination and antisense.
* Provides learning objectives for each chapter.
* Includes a list of relevant videos from the internet about the topics covered in the chapter.
